A Hurricane: Another drink
The Hurricane is another amazing drink that is very Gulf Coast and caribbean. Enjoy!
The
Hurricane*
(With a
tip of Top Hat's hat to Pat O'Brien, who invented it for his New Orleans'
establishment. A place which
should be on every first-time visitor to New Orleans' list of places to
visit. And if you don't drink,
enjoy the food!)
Ingredients
(make it as nasty as you want it to be):
One part
white rum
One part
dark rum
One part
high-octane dark rum
"Passion
fruit" syrup (There's also a mix available from Pat O'Brien's, or you can
use something like Red Hawaiian Punch, if it's around still.)
Lime
juice
Prep:
Pour all
ingredients into a shake with ice
Shake
well
Pour into
glass over additional ice
*Do Not drink and drive after this one...it will BLOW YOU AWAY!

The Zombie: A cocktail
And the part continues! This is one of a couple of drink recipes for your own zombie party or Mardi Gras madness:
The
Zombie Cocktail*
Ingredients:
1 1/4 oz.
lemon juice
3/4 oz.
orange juice
1 oz.
dark rum
1/2 oz.
light rum
1/2 oz.
high-octane dark rum
1/2 oz.
cherry brandy
Couple
dashes of grenadine syrup
Prep:
Pour all
ingredients into a shaker with ice.
Shake
well
Strain
into a glass
*Don't you dare even attempt to drive after consuming this drink...it's a brain killer!
An American Apocalypse: Preview
Click the cover image for a .pdf preview for An American Apocalypse:
An American Apocalypse is a graphic novel about the failed clean up and relief efforts after Hurricane Katrina. It mixes political satire, and hoodoo mysticism to create a compelling zombie story that is ripe with political opinion.
PS-The last page has August 28th, 2005 as Hurricane Katrina's landfall date. The correct date is the 29th of August, 2005. I was made aware of this point after the preview was completed...it will be updated for the graphic novel.

More Character Designs
Doctor David Velasquez character concepts
Catherine (Cate) Marchand character concepts
Cate and David are both major role players in the story An American Apocalypse. Cate is a TV news reporter sent to New Orleans to cover Hurricane Katrina, before, during, and after the storm. Dr. David Velasquez is a professor of religious studies at a New Orleans University. He has an office at the medical center downtown and helps with police investigations.
